Today, former PA Senator Rick Santorum officially announced his candidacy for president in 2012. Either because she was so excited, so overwhelmed, or just hot, a woman in the crowd fainted during the speech. Santorum had to stop his speech and his wife left the stage to go to the woman’s side:
While it was an awkward moment, the Hill reports Santorum eventually led the crowd in a silent prayer for the woman. She was apparently taken away on a stretcher.
